#202155 Color
#202155 is rgb(32, 33, 85) in RGB, hsl(239, 45%, 23%) in HSL, and about cmyk(62%, 61%, 0%, 67%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Space Cadet (#1D2951),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 9.79.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#202155 Channel Values
How #202155 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 32 · G 33 · B 85 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 239° · S 45% · L 23%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 239° · S 62% · V 33%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 62% · M 61% · Y 0% · K 67%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 14.89:1 vs white · 1.41: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#202155 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#202155 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#202155?
#202155 is a dark blue — rgb(32, 33, 85) in RGB and hsl(239, 45%, 23%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Space Cadet (#1D2951),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 9.79.
What is the RGB value of #202155?
#202155 is rgb(32, 33, 85) — red 32, green 33, and blue 85 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#202155?
#202155 converts to approximately cmyk(62%, 61%, 0%, 67%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#202155 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#202155 scores 14.89:1 against white and 1.41: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#202155 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#202155 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kslateblue (#483D8B) at a CIE76 distance of 19.86, which is visibly different.
